To Marry a Texas Outlaw: Men of Legend, Book 3

Linda Broday. Sourcebooks Casablanca, $7.99 mass market (352p) ISBN 978-1-4926-3023-4

Broday’s dramatic third Men of Legend romance (after The Heart of a Texas Cowboy) centers on Luke Weston, a half-Spanish outlaw on the 19th-century Texas frontier. Luke, who has been falsely accused of killing a federal judge, wants to clear his name, which means finding the real killer. But rescuing an amnesiac woman from a posse of thugs complicates his search. As Josie Morgan tries to regain her memory and they fall prey to their strong mutual attraction, the two travel all over seeking their answers. Luke’s insistence that he is unworthy of love and unable to settle down comes across as a sincere, as do his fierce protection of the weak and powerful anger toward abusers. The pair encounter boastful bounty hunters and an abused little boy, navigate Luke’s strained relationship with his father and half-brothers, and use Josie’s impressive acting abilities and Luke’s steely gunslinging to survive battles. This densely plotted historical continues Broday’s tradition of well-realized, emotionally rich novels. Agent: Gail Fortune, Talbot Fortune. (Nov.)
